Michelmores acts on deal that saved over 30 jobs in Exeter

Michelmores’ Banking, Restructuring and Insolvency team have acted for the administrators in a deal to save more than 30 jobs at an Exeter-based groundworks and highway maintenance business.

Michelmores’ Sacha Pickering acted for Michelle Weir of Lameys and Julie Palmer of Begbies Traynor who were appointed as joint administrators of three companies in the AC group, AC Landscape & Tree Works Limited, AC Garage Services and AC Training Limited.

The business was sold to a successor company through a pre-pack sale, with the majority of jobs being saved.  Contracts for the provision of critical highways maintenance services on a national scale have also been successfully preserved.
